For the airlines, I have heard this recommendation:
to get a few pieces of nylon cable tie (for electrical cables, sometimes called nytie or ziptie.... available at hardware stores) and zip it through the kennel and wire grate. (you might have to drill a small hole in the kennel).
They do make a very heavy duty one, about a quarter-inch wide. We use it for securing anchors in stormy weather, I think it could withstand the dog's chewing.
As an added bonus, no one could let the dog out without you knowing, because the only way to get the cable off is to cut it with wire cutters. Tough stuff.
